> Subject: [PATCH RFT] serial: imx: fix a race condition in receive path
>
> ---
> drivers/tty/serial/imx.c | 52 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++----------
> 1 file changed, 39 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/tty/serial/imx.c b/drivers/tty/serial/imx.c index
> a9e20e6c63ad..679b2de27c4d 100644
> --- a/drivers/tty/serial/imx.c
> +++ b/drivers/tty/serial/imx.c
> @@ -700,22 +700,33 @@ static void imx_uart_start_tx(struct uart_port
> *port)
> }
> }
>
> -static irqreturn_t imx_uart_rtsint(int irq, void *dev_id)
> +static irqreturn_t __imx_uart_rtsint(int irq, void *dev_id)
> {
> struct imx_port *sport = dev_id;
> u32 usr1;
>
> - spin_lock(&sport->port.lock);
> -
> imx_uart_writel(sport, USR1_RTSD, USR1);
> usr1 = imx_uart_readl(sport, USR1) & USR1_RTSS;
> uart_handle_cts_change(&sport->port, !!usr1);
> wake_up_interruptible(&sport->port.state->port.delta_msr_wait);
>
> - spin_unlock(&sport->port.lock);
> return I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> +static irqreturn_t imx_uart_rtsint(int irq, void *dev_id) {
> + struct imx_port *sport = dev_id;
> + irqreturn_t ret;
> +
> + spin_lock(&sport->port.lock);
> +
> + ret = __imx_uart_rtsint(irq, dev_id);
> +
> + spin_unlock(&sport->port.lock);
> +
> + return ret;
> +}
> +
> static irqreturn_t imx_uart_txint(int irq, void *dev_id) {
> struct imx_port *sport = dev_id; @@ -726,14 +737,12 @@ static
> irqreturn_t imx_uart_txint(int irq, void *dev_id)
> return I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> -static irqreturn_t imx_uart_rxint(int irq, void *dev_id)
> +static irqreturn_t __imx_uart_rxint(int irq, void *dev_id)
> {
> struct imx_port *sport = dev_id;
> unsigned int rx, flg, ignored = 0;
> struct tty_port *port = &sport->port.state->port;
>
> - spin_lock(&sport->port.lock);
> -
> while (imx_uart_readl(sport, USR2) & USR2_RDR) {
> u32 usr2;
>
> @@ -792,11 +801,26 @@ static irqreturn_t imx_uart_rxint(int irq, void
> *dev_id)
> }
>
> out:
> - spin_unlock(&sport->port.lock);
> tty_flip_buffer_push(port);
> +
> return I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> +static irqreturn_t imx_uart_rxint(int irq, void *dev_id) {
> + struct imx_port *sport = dev_id;
> + struct tty_port *port = &sport->port.state->port;
> + irqreturn_t ret;
> +
> + spin_lock(&sport->port.lock);
> +
> + ret = __imx_uart_rxint(irq, dev_id);
> +
> + spin_unlock(&sport->port.lock);
> +
> + return ret;
> +}
> +
> static void imx_uart_clear_rx_errors(struct imx_port *sport);
>
> /*
> @@ -855,6 +879,8 @@ static irqreturn_t imx_uart_int(int irq, void *dev_id)
> unsigned int usr1, usr2, ucr1, ucr2, ucr3, ucr4;
> irqreturn_t ret = IRQ_NONE;
>
> + spin_lock(&sport->port.lock);
> +
> usr1 = imx_uart_readl(sport, USR1);
> usr2 = imx_uart_readl(sport, USR2);
> ucr1 = imx_uart_readl(sport, UCR1); @@ -888,27 +914,25 @@
> static irqreturn_t imx_uart_int(int irq, void *dev_id)
> usr2 &= ~USR2_ORE;
>
> if (usr1 & (USR1_RRDY | USR1_AGTIM)) {
> - imx_uart_rxint(irq, dev_id);
> + __imx_uart_rxint(irq, dev_id);
> ret = I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> if ((usr1 & USR1_TRDY) || (usr2 & USR2_TXDC)) {
> - imx_uart_txint(irq, dev_id);
> + imx_uart_transmit_buffer(sport);
> ret = I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> if (usr1 & USR1_DTRD) {
> imx_uart_writel(sport, USR1_DTRD, USR1);
>
> - spin_lock(&sport->port.lock);
> imx_uart_mctrl_check(sport);
> - spin_unlock(&sport->port.lock);
>
> ret = I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> if (usr1 & USR1_RTSD) {
> - imx_uart_rtsint(irq, dev_id);
> + __imx_uart_rtsint(irq, dev_id);
> ret = I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> @@ -923,6 +947,8 @@ static irqreturn_t imx_uart_int(int irq, void *dev_id)
> ret = IRQ_HANDLED;
> }
>
> + spin_unlock(&sport->port.lock);
> +
> return ret;
> }
